Anokiwave is a manufacturer of silicon core chips and front-end integrated circuits for millimeter-wave (mmW) markets, specifically targeting active antenna-based solutions. Their technology enables SATCOM, RADAR, EW, COMMS, and Space applications. Anokiwave partners with organizations like Ball Aerospace to develop advanced antenna architectures and provide ICs for Ku and K/Ka-band broadband services, focusing on improving performance and reducing costs for satellite communication terminals.

Anokiwave provides OEMs application expertise aimed at improving array designs and accelerating time to market for mmW phased array antenna systems.
Anokiwave supplies silicon SATCOM beamforming integrated circuits to Requtech that improve performance, reduce cost, simplify thermal management, and provide digital functionality to simplify system design.
Anokiwave is based in Boston, Massachusetts and operates design centers in Austin, Texas, Boston, Massachusetts, and San Diego, California.
